Pianist and composer Alex Koo is hailed by the renowned American Downbeat Jazz Magazine as "stunningly original" and is known for his genre-bending music. Seemingly effortlessly, he blends jazz with contemporary classical music, elements of film music, and even indie.

Koo began his musical career as a classical prodigy at the age of five, and in his teens, he developed a passion for jazz and improvisation. He quickly garnered praise from jazz legends like Kenny Werner and Brad Mehldau. "Of the same rare, high caliber as Keith Jarrett," writes Trouw.

In 2025, "Blame It on My Chromosomes" was released on W.E.R.F. Records, featuring ten unique and personal tracks. Featuring Dré Pallemaerts on drums and Lennart Heyndels on bass, the trio is synonymous with daring ensemble playing and musical fireworks. Considered by many to be the best in Belgian jazz. For this album, Koo collaborated with internationally acclaimed trumpeter Ambrose Akinmusire, who plays on two tracks. It's already a truly magnificent album!
